Where to go for the best food and drinks, live music, and views of the track

It’s about to get loud this weekend! From 14 to 16 September, the F1 Singapore Grand Prix returns for its 11th year straight that is set to draw a ton of locals, visitors and international stars to Marina Bay. Tickets have been selling like hotcakes, and unless you’re living the high life, you probably hesitated at the sight of the triple digits.

But even if attending the races and concerts are not in the cards for you, don’t rule out joining in the race-themed revelry just yet! Hip venues all across town are going all out to make sure you have a blast whether you’re coming hot off the track for more electrifying fun, or just want to hop on the high-energy train. Filled with their own line-up of show-stopping musical artists, and amazing top views of the track, these F1 parties are set to get your pulse racing with no clock on fun.

1. Zouk

Zouk is pulling out all the stops this F1 Weekend by hosting an after-party inspired by another kind of racing game – retro 8-bit video games. From 14 to 16 September, the club will be decked out in nostalgic visuals of our favourite old-school video games, providing a colourful backdrop as you dance the night away. Popular Zouk themed music nights CODE and Total Recall make a smashing return on Friday and Saturday respectively, while the highly demanded Dutch DJ R3HAB brings the house down with his thumping beats on Saturday. Rounding out the exhilarating weekend on Sunday is a special performance by British R&B crooner Jay Sean.
